The Adventures of Tom Sawyer

The Adventures of Tom Sawyer

Author: Mark Twain
 Number of pages: 282


An orphan and his brother Sydney came to live to St. Petersburg after their mother's death with their aunt Polly. Polly finds Tom eating out of the jam closet, During dinner aunt Polly tries to trick Tom into admitting that he played hockey from school that day to go swimming. Aunt Polly apologizes to Tom for being suspicious , then tom's brother wants to be the cool Boy of the village, points out that Tom's shirt is sewn together with black thread instead of the white thread that Aunt Polly had used that morning. Before she can punish him, Tom runs away from the house. In the street Tom runs into a well-dressed boy,  after a verbal fight, Tom and the nameless boy begin to fight at each other until Tom finally wins. Tom returns home late in the evening by climbing in through the window, but Aunt Polly catches him.
